Srinagar: The Jammu and Kashmir Police arrested a Jaish-e-Mohammad (JeM) militant in Budgam district of the union territory, officials said on Thursday. Tariq Ahmad Bhat was arrested during a ‘naka’ checking late on Wednesday night, the police officials said. They said a pistol and some incriminating material were recovered from his possession. Bhat had reportedly joined militant ranks in September this year.
